Lincoln is a city in Placer County in the U.S. state of California. It has about 42 819 inhabitants ( 2010 census ).
Lincoln was founded in 1859 by Theodore D. Judah. The city is named in honor of Charles Lincoln Wilson, one of the directors of the railway company Central California, named.
